What Are Medical Billing and Coding?
Before diving into online programs, it’s important to understand the core functions of medical billing and coding:
- Medical Billing: The process of generating and submitting claims to insurance companies for healthcare services provided, ensuring provider reimbursement.
- Medical Coding: The translation of healthcare services into standardized codes (ICD-10,CPT,HCPCS),which are used for billing,statistics,and healthcare management.
These roles are essential for healthcare facilities, insurance companies, and patients, making trained professionals highly sought after in the health sector.

How to Choose the Right Online Medical Billing and Coding School
Choosing the right school is critical for your career success. Here are key factors to consider:
- Accreditation: Ensure the program is accredited by recognized agencies such as the Distance Education Accrediting Commission (DEAC) or CAAHEP.
- Curriculum Content: Look for programs that cover ICD-10, CPT, HCPCS coding systems, insurance procedures, and compliance.
- Certification Planning: confirm whether the program prepares students for certifications like CPC, CCS, or CCSP.
- Cost and Payment Options: Compare tuition fees and see if the school offers financial aid or payment plans.
- Student Support: Access to tutors,counselors,and career services can significantly enhance your learning experience.
- reviews and Success Rates: Research student feedback and employment placement rates.

Certification and Licensing: The Next Step
While completing an online program provides foundational skills, obtaining professional certification significantly enhances employability:
- Certified Professional Coder (CPC) – Offered by the American Academy of Professional coders (AAPC).
- Certified Coding Specialist (CCS) – Provided by the American Health Information Management Association (AHIMA).
- Certified Medical Reimbursement Specialist (CMRS) – For billing focus, offered by the American Medical Billing Association (AMBA).
Most online courses prepare students for these certification exams through targeted training modules.
